1 definition by Gao guangming

Top Definition
Global Connection (GC) is the world’s biggest community of expat partners with over 6.000 members in more than 125 countries.
The Global Connection Project develops software tools and technologies to increase the power of images to connect, inform, and inspire people to become engaged and responsible global citizens.
by Gao guangming May 12, 2007

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.